Horace Gould was born on 20 September 1918 and represented British in Formula 1. That biographical starting point precedes a World Championship career reconstructed here through seasons, teams and official race results. The Formula 1 World Championship debut came in 1954, and the journey lasted until 1960. Across 7 championship seasons, the driver faced changing cars, regulations and generations of rivals.
